The Childern of Man.Sorcerer
After a brief period of time in which i planned how this
model would be assembled, I have finished the Sorcerer for my Chaos Marines.
Behold.
He is a combination of the chaos marine and warrior kits,
with a lot of green stuff used. A modelling knife was used to create the cuts
in his armour.

The Childern of Man. Chosen and Obliterators
After a few days of manic activity i have finally finished modeling my Chaos Space Marine Chosen and Obliterators. Before i go on here they are in all their unpainted glory.
The Obliterators were simply the finecast kit plastic warriors of chaos heads where as the chosen were a combination of the cape and head from the warrior of chaos kit and the front chest piece, legs, arms and weapons from the chaos space marine kit, and lots of green stuff.

The Children of Man. The Foot Soilders
After 24 hours of a mixture of hard work/waiting for green
stuff to dry I have finished my first squad of Malal aligned chaos space
marines. Before I go on here they are in all their unpainted glory.
These guys are a combination of the warriors of chaos box
set and chaos space marines box set (and green stuff). They were created using
the legs and front part of the chest from the chaos warrior box with the chaos
space marine back piece, with green stuff filling in the gap between the legs
and back . The helmets are a mixture of the warriors of chaos and chaos space
marines and the arms are the basic chaos space marine ones without the shoulder
pads. This idea was not mine originally,
it came from a white dwarf issue that was showcasing an army of Chaos Space
Marine Iron warriors where the player wanted a unique look for his troops.
Wanting a similar different look for my own army I used his idea for basic
chaos space marines.
